Color Palette Examples
- Palette 1: Warm & Supportive – This palette utilizes warm tones to evoke feelings of comfort and generosity. Deep terracotta, a warm golden yellow, and a soft cream create a harmonious and inviting aesthetic. Terracotta represents earthiness and strength, while the yellow instills a sense of joy and optimism. The cream color provides a neutral backdrop that complements the other colors.
This palette is well-suited for conveying a sense of community and togetherness.
- Palette 2: Hopeful & Modern – This palette combines a vibrant teal with a soft, calming lavender. Teal evokes feelings of trust, dependability, and stability, while lavender symbolizes peace, serenity, and calmness. This combination of colors creates a sense of hope and serenity. The palette effectively conveys the mission of providing essential support to the community. A subtle, muted grey can be used as a neutral.
- Palette 3: Compassionate & Engaging – This palette uses a rich, deep forest green combined with a warm, sunny orange. Forest green symbolizes nature, health, and prosperity. Orange conveys energy, enthusiasm, and a sense of optimism. A muted, light beige or cream can be used to create contrast and balance the palette. This combination of colors creates a sense of vitality and compassion, aligning with the North Texas Food Bank’s commitment to community well-being.

Font Characteristics and Possible Associations
Different font styles have inherent characteristics that can evoke specific feelings or associations. A sans-serif font, for example, is often perceived as modern, clean, and straightforward. A serif font, conversely, can suggest sophistication, tradition, and a sense of authority. Logo Variations and Adaptations

A strong brand identity hinges on a versatile logo that adapts seamlessly to various applications. Effective logo variations are crucial for maintaining brand recognition and consistency across different mediums, from social media to physical merchandise. This adaptability ensures your brand remains instantly recognizable, no matter the context.Adaptability is key for successful brand communication. A logo designed for print may not translate well to a mobile phone screen.
Variations allow the logo to maintain its core identity while accommodating the unique characteristics of each platform, thus maximizing impact and visibility.
Logo Variations for Different Applications
Different applications demand different logo variations. For instance, a logo designed for a website might need to be optimized for smaller sizes, while a logo for a billboard needs to be robust and easily readable from a distance.
- Social Media: Social media logos require a smaller, yet impactful version of the main logo. They need to be easily identifiable within the constraints of profile pictures and feed posts. Compressing the logo for use on platforms like Twitter, Instagram, and Facebook ensures the logo maintains its visual appeal without losing essential elements.
- Merchandise: Merchandise applications, like t-shirts or mugs, need a larger, high-resolution logo that’s both clear and visually appealing at various scales. The logo must remain legible and maintain its aesthetic quality when printed on a variety of materials and colors.
- Print Materials: Printed materials, such as brochures and flyers, necessitate a logo that’s easily readable in print. Consider using a higher resolution and slightly larger version of the logo than for digital use. The logo must maintain clarity and impact in the printed medium.
- Website: Website logos need to be optimized for web use. They need to be vector-based for scaling without losing quality and to maintain their resolution even when displayed on various screen sizes. Web-optimized logos are essential for a consistent brand presence across the website.

Logo Resizing and Visual Appeal
Logo resizing is critical for maintaining visual appeal and brand recognition. Improper resizing can distort the logo, making it appear unprofessional or unclear. Using vector graphics ensures scalability without compromising quality.
- Vector Graphics: Vector graphics are essential for logo resizing. They allow for scaling the logo to different sizes without losing resolution or clarity. Vector graphics are the preferred choice for creating variations and adapting to various applications.
- Resolution Optimization: Optimizing resolution is crucial. High-resolution images are necessary for print, while lower-resolution versions are suitable for digital use. This balance is crucial for efficient file sizes and optimal visual quality.
- Maintaining Proportions: Maintaining the original proportions of the logo during resizing is important for maintaining its visual identity. Avoid distorting the logo by stretching or compressing it. Proportionality is essential for brand recognition.
